Transaction 91a062037e1df40afae891f013de5051cbb77a442edb422e9a3203cc209e60bd

1 Input
2 Outputs
  • 91a062037e1df40afae891f013de5051cbb77a442edb422e9a3203cc209e60bd:0
  • value  280217
    address  15mmRbEEBzF3vr6i8zBLehAoYVvmaXdHyC
  • 91a062037e1df40afae891f013de5051cbb77a442edb422e9a3203cc209e60bd:1
  • value  21879464
    address  13HaE9x6wFbCiSeGhADptoKw5UdWGwC9d9